Front Yard Desert Landscaping on a Budget: Where to Start

Sep 6, 2023 | Exterior Design | 0 comments

Desert landscaping is an excellent choice for homeowners looking to create a beautiful front yard without breaking the bank. Not only does it offer a unique aesthetic, but it’s also low-maintenance and water-efficient. In this article, we’ll guide you through the initial steps of front yard desert landscaping on a budget, ensuring you get the most bang for your buck.A desert landscaping with a house

Assess Your Space and Soil

Before diving into any landscaping project, it’s crucial to assess your front yard’s size and soil type. Knowing these details will help you choose the right plants and materials for your desert landscape. Conduct a soil test to determine its pH and nutrient levels, as this will influence your plant choices.

Choosing the Right Plants

When it comes to front yard desert landscaping on a budget, selecting the right plants is key. Opt for native plants like cacti, succulents, and desert flowers, which are not only beautiful but also require less water and maintenance. Research plants that thrive in your specific climate zone to ensure they will flourish.

Incorporating Hardscape Elements

Hardscape elements like rocks, gravel, and pavers can add texture and depth to your front yard. These materials are generally affordable and can be arranged in various patterns to create a visually appealing landscape. Consider creating a rock garden or a gravel pathway to add interest to your yard.A desert landscaping front yard with a pathway

Water-Efficient Irrigation Systems

One of the benefits of desert landscaping is its water efficiency. However, some plants may still require occasional watering. Drip irrigation systems are an economical and efficient way to keep your plants hydrated. These systems deliver water directly to the plant roots, reducing water waste.

DIY vs. Professional Help

While doing it yourself can save money, some aspects of desert landscaping may require professional help. Weigh the pros and cons and decide what tasks you can handle and what might be better left to the experts. For instance, installing an irrigation system might require specialized knowledge.

Front yard desert landscaping doesn’t have to be expensive. By carefully planning, choosing the right plants and materials, and considering water efficiency, you can create a stunning front yard that won’t break the bank. With a little creativity and effort, your budget-friendly desert oasis is within reach.
